#eb5288 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eb5288 is composed of 92.2% red, 32.2%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.1% magenta, 42.1%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 338.8 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 62.2%. #eb5288 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4ff with #d70011.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#eb5288 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eb5288 has RGB values of R:235, G:82,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.42,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15422088.

Shades and Tints of #eb5288
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030001 is the darkest color, while #fdf0f5 is the lightest one.
